IP查询
查询
你查询的IP:[60.63.51.131] 地理位置:中国–上海–上海电信/东方有线
最新查询
123.96.23.71
210.2.239.63
116.196.143.46
123.8.73.207
121.170.16.1
121.201.86.137
119.40.94.27
123.8.33.213
118.112.80.2
60.63.51.131
61.8.160.238
222.176.102.179
203.135.160.151
210.23.32.79
203.174.7.197
202.127.40.162
114.64.140.244
122.240.102.234
123.249.16.178
203.192.146.236
121.51.110.111
124.242.30.33
124.20.59.185
116.242.109.36
121.52.160.47
119.15.136.190
202.22.248.217
124.240.128.229
202.38.176.155
116.76.95.151
202.41.240.38